Audio Stream:
Audio stream requires the most recent version of Real Player, which you can download for free at: http://real.com.
You should be able to click on the audio stream link provided in your email confirmation or written up above, up to 15 minutes before the call time. The audio stream should either open directly in Real Player or ask you to first "save to disk" and then open the file manually, but if you have problems with this (most likely because you are on a MAC), the solution is to open the RealPlayer application on your computer, go to "File" and click on "New Browser." Copy the audio stream link into the browser, hit "enter" or "return" on your keypad, and the stream should start.
